Peasants, the Chinese workers, gather at the same rate as Greek Villagers. Scout Cavalry act similarly to the Greek Kataskopos in the early game, scouting around the map, while also capturing nearby herdable animals. The Chinese start out with a Town Center, two Scout Cavalry, and four Peasants. The first two Gardens are cheaper to construct, but only the first time they are built, not if rebuilt. Peasants can construct up to ten Gardens, each new one increasing the generation of favor. Like the Egyptians, the Chinese must construct a building in order to gather favor, in their case the Garden, with each one providing a continuous trickle.
